Croydon bubble tea entrepreneurs pick up prestigious award

TeaJoy, a new bubble tea brand, has been named London Startup of the Year in the Food and Drink category at the UK StartUp Awards 2025.

TeaJoy joy: Ning Ma and Jack Gaskin were named London’s food and drink start-up of the year 

Co-founded by Croydon-based entrepreneur duo Ning Ma and Jack Gaskin, the judges said that TeaJoy “stood out for its bold innovation, rapid growth, and joyful approach to bringing ready-to-drink bubble tea to the UK market”.

TeaJoy began in the kitchen of MamaLan restaurant in Brixton during lockdown and is now a fast-growing brand which is set to launch a range of canned bubble teas next month.

“We’re incredibly proud and grateful to receive this recognition,” said Ning after accepting the award at a ceremony held in the West End.

“This award celebrates the entrepreneurial spirit that’s been part of TeaJoy since Day One. What started as a dream is now a reality, a bubble tea brand designed to bring more joy to everyday moments with every pop, sip and smile.”

The rapidly growing bubble tea market, driven by Gen Z consumers, has a global market projected to surpass £2billion by 2028.

TeaJoy supplies more than 500 outlets across the country, from independents to national chains, offering easy-to-serve commercial kits without the need for specialist equipment. The canned drinks aims to expand the brand’s reach even further, bringing bubble tea into the hands of everyday consumers.

All TeaJoy products are made with real fruit juice and premium tea. The boba contains no artificial colours, the instant tapioca is exclusive to the brand, and all drinks are vegan and allergen-free.

The UK StartUp Awards, created by the team behind the Great British Entrepreneur Awards and Fast Growth 50 Index, celebrate the most promising early-stage businesses across the country. With more than 35 categories and entries spanning 10 regions, the awards offer national recognition, industry exposure, and valuable connections for the next generation of business leaders.

TeaJoy’s win places them among the top startups in the country, with all regional winners now advancing to compete at the national final later this year.
